Weekend incidents 17/18/19 January

An electric kettle accidentally placed on a gas hob sparked a fire at a bungalow on Caine Gardens in Kimberworth on Friday night. Rotherham and Elm Lane firefighters spent around 50 minutes dealing with the incident, which started shortly before 9pm.

Dearne firefighters spent 30 minutes dealing with a car fire on Beechville Avenue in Swinton on Friday night. The blaze was started deliberately around 11.30pm.

Cudworth firefighters dealt with a fire involving a Ford Fiesta on Royston Road around 2.30am on Saturday. The cause of the fire is not known.

Firefighters from Dearne fire station tackled a car fire on Dearne Road just before 10am on Saturday. The fire started accidentally.

An hour was spent by firefighters from Elm Lane, Tankersley and Rotherham fire stations dealing with a house fire on Bradgate Lane. The fire involved an airing cupboard and is thought to have been caused by some faulty wiring. No one was hurt in the blaze. The fire started just before 10am on Saturday.

A lorry caught fire on Shawfield Road in Carlton, caused by some welding work being undertaken on the cab. Barnsley and Cudworth firefighters dealt with it around 10am on Saturday.

A white transit van was set alight on Carr Road, Deepcar at around 3.30am on Sunday. Tankersley firefighters were at the scene for around 45 minutes.

A scooter was set alight on Tickhill Square, Denaby Main just before 1pm on Sunday. Edlington fire crew attended the incident.

A postbox on Wellgate in Rotherham town centre was set alight just after 4pm on Sunday. Rotherham firefighters wer on the scene for about 10 minutes.
